Optimization of micropillar microfabrication process for heterogeneous integration

Advanced packaging and high-density chip stacking technologies are pivotal in the evolution of microelectronics, enabling enhanced performance through heterogeneous integration. As the industry moves toward reducing bump size and pitch, the bonding methodology has shifted from solder balls to Cu pillars. Behavioral Dysfunctions After Preterm Birth: The Role of Vasopressin

This project aims to explore the role of arginine vasopressin (AVP) in cognitive and anxiety-like behavior dysfunctions observed in preterm birth models. Using a neonatal hyperoxia rat model, which mimics bronchopulmonary dysplasia (BPD) and associated complications of preterm birth, the study will assess behavioral outcomes and AVP levels in different experimental conditions.
